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

Asbestos lawyers are dedicated to helping families and victims get the financial recovery they need and deserve. These attorneys are employed by national companies with access to asbestos databases and a track record of winning significant cases and settlements.

They assist mesothelioma patients to make a personal injury or wrongful-death lawsuit against the companies that caused their exposure. The majority of these lawsuits are settled prior to trial.

Find the financial support you require

Financial assistance can help reduce stress during treatment and pay for medical expenses. It can also help you to make ends meet. Mesothelioma compensation can assist you in paying for your future and past care, medical bills, legal costs as well as lost wages, the loss of capacity to earn as well as pain and suffering and other damages. The amount you receive varies depending on the state you reside in and the type of mesothelioma. There are three different types of mesothelioma claims which include personal injury, wrongful deaths, and trust fund claim. A personal injury lawsuit seeks to recover compensation from the person who caused your illness. This is the most frequent mesothelioma type of case. Families of mesothelioma patients can claim wrongful deaths to seek compensation from the company(ies) responsible for the death of the victim. A mesothelioma trust fund claim can be filed with one of the numerous asbestos trust funds set up by the federal government or individual asbestos companies.

It could take years to settle a lawsuit. A fair settlement could be difficult to negotiate. Certain asbestos companies try to delay the process by filing frivolous lawsuits. Your mesothelioma lawyer is skilled at identifying and rebutting these strategies.

There are different laws which apply based on the state in which you live and what type of asbestos exposure you experienced. Certain states have a shorter time limit while others have a longer period of time.

A mesothelioma-related trial may last for a long time. Judges may accelerate the trial if the plaintiff has a short life expectancy or is in a severe health condition. The judge who is in charge will decide whether there is a reason to speed up the trial. The court will then order the defendants to respond to the plaintiff's allegations.

The VA healthcare system can provide veterans with access to the most skilled mesothelioma specialists in the country and disability compensation. The VA also provides mesothelioma-specific nursing care to patients. Mesothelioma lawyers can explain how to combine the advantages of these programs to provide you with the most comprehensive amount of compensation that is available.

Asbestos manufacturers have hidden the dangers in their products for a long time, causing many victims to suffer. They knew that asbestos caused illnesses and death, yet they continued to use the product in their structures, ships vehicles, homes, and even in their homes. Many of these businesses have gone bankrupt and their assets have been put into trust funds. These trust funds provide money to mesothelioma patients as well as asbestosis patients and other asbestos-related illnesses.
